Output 63402d55cb815be5d46661ce81c3055280723a595c88f1a0a95b0c344ee5f705:0

value
991705
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de00a2c8112ddfc86c118069065e89cc34b13b15 OP_EQUAL
address
3MvrhJynibkKVafLXBmCPFZcSwbnvHYpJq
transaction
63402d55cb815be5d46661ce81c3055280723a595c88f1a0a95b0c344ee5f705
spent
true